101CVPost card collection with a theme of the US American Fleet's visit to Japan and the Philippines in 1908. Amazing assortment with over 100 cards many from Japan. Interesting on both sides; the picture side and the philatelic side of the cards. Several are in color including actual pictures, depicting a golden era of naval goodwill, and a show of the strength of the US Navy as the Great White Fleet visited all ports of call. Great addition to any military history or battleship collection.Cat. Value: S.B. 500.00

136O*A mature Federal Duck assembly starting with RW1 and going into the modern era. The highlights are mostly in the modern material such as #’s RW72b with a black artist signature (only 750 were signed in black), RW73b x2 without the engraver’s signature, RW74b x2, RW75b x2, RW76b, RW77b, RW78b, RW79b, RW80b, 1992 precursor Junior Duck sheet of 9, JBS1-JBS3. Some peripheral paper ephemera also is noted. To a lesser extent you will also find some duck on license and other wild game material towards the end of the group. Great presentation of a very popular collecting area.Cat. Value: S.B. 650.00

200*1949 UPU collection in a White Ace binder with slipcase and on White Ace pages in a binder. Hundreds and hundreds of mint stamps in full sets, singles, and souvenir sheets complete for the provided pages nicely mounted by the collector mainly in black mounts. Includes the often not encountered complete set of twelve Belgian Congo and Ruanda-Urundi deluxe miniature sheets (hinged, toned gum, as found) printed by the Committee of Cultural Works having only 300 sets. With the 70th Anniversary of these issues coming up in less than two years, an opportunity to get in on the ground floor.Cat. Value: S.B. 800.00
